Lincoln Electric is the world leader in the engineering, design, and manufacturing of advanced arc welding solutions, automated joining, assembly and cutting systems, plasma and oxy-fuel cutting equipment, and has a leading global position in brazing and soldering alloys. Lincoln is recognized as the Welding Expert™ for its leading materials science, software development, automation engineering, and application expertise, which advance customers' fabrication capabilities to help them build a better world.

About the role

Under the general direction of a Lead, the Project Manager is responsible for planning, executing, and delivering complex projects that require significant resources and cross-functional coordination. This role owns all aspects of the project lifecycle—from initiation through closeout—and ensures projects are delivered on time, within scope, and in alignment with quality, financial, and business objectives. The Project Manager must maintain a comprehensive understanding of project scope, objectives, and deliverables, as well as the roles and responsibilities of all team members.

This position is responsible for assembling and leading the appropriate project team, assigning responsibilities, identifying required resources, and developing detailed schedules to ensure successful project execution. Projects are managed from initial concept through final implementation. The Project Manager interfaces with all stakeholders impacted by the project, including internal teams, end users, distributors, vendors, and external partners. This role ensures adherence to applicable quality standards and conducts final reviews of project deliverables.

The Project Manager may also communicate project status, risks, and performance metrics to executive leadership and business unit leaders. A strong financial and business acumen is required. The Project Manager must be proficient in maintaining and interpreting project financial workbooks, including but not limited to Gross Margin, Operating Profit, Backlog, and SG&A calculations. The role requires advanced Excel skills, including the ability to diagnose and correct broken formulas, develop new formulas, and present financial data from an executive-level perspective. Experience working within ERP systems is required, including the ability to generate reports for project tracking and ensure the accuracy and integrity of reported data.

Position is on premises in Plymouth, Michigan. Ability to travel approximately 25%. Due to travel, US Passport preferred.
